细胞自噬中关键蛋白乙酰化修饰与相关疾病诊治的研究进展

摘    要:自噬是一种在进化上保守的溶酶体依赖的降解途径.近十多年来,自噬过程的分子机制研究得到了长足的发展.自噬过程中关键蛋白复合物的乙酰化修饰发挥了十分重要的作用.为此,该文阐述了细胞自噬过程中主要蛋白复合物的乙酰化修饰作用进展,并对蛋白质乙酰化修饰与肿瘤、神经退行性疾病等的关系作一总结.总之,自噬过程中蛋白乙酰化修饰已经成为...

Research Progresses of Acetylation of Key Protein in Cell Autophagy and the Treatment of Related Diseases

Abstract:Autophagy is a conserved pathway that delivers cytoplasmic contents to the lysosome for degradation.In the past decade,the molecular mechanisms underlying autophagy have been extensively studied.Importantly,the key role of acetylated autophagy complexes has been identified and elucidated.This review systematically summarizes the current knowledge of acetylation of the key autophagy complexes,the function of these modifications,and their therapeutic functional implications in cancer and neurodegenerative diseases.In conclusion,acetylation has become the hot talk of autophagy researches.Understanding the acetylation of the autophagy machinery offers a unique window for the control of autophagy-related diseases.
